GeoGet

Complete geocaching solutions

User Tools

Site Tools


user:skripty:pspad

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
user:skripty:pspad [2012/07/16 15:26] – Oprava uvozovek valicek1user:skripty:pspad [Unknown date] (current) – external edit (Unknown date) 127.0.0.1
Line 1: Line 1:
 ====== Psaní skriptů v programu PSPad ====== ====== Psaní skriptů v programu PSPad ======
-Vedle standardního [[user:menu:nastroje#editor_skriptu|editoru skriptů]] integrovaného v programu GeoGet, lze k psaní skriptů používat jakýkoli jiný program od základního poznámkového bloku až třeba po výborný [[http://www.pspad.cz|PSPad]].+Vedle standardního [[user:menu:nastroje#editor_skriptu|editoru skriptů]] integrovaného v programu GeoGet, lze k psaní skriptů používat jakýkoli jiný program od základního poznámkového bloku až třeba po výborný [[http://www.pspad.cz|PSPad]]. Pokud raději preferujete [[user:skripty:notepadpp|Notepad++, návod naleznete zde]].
  
 {{:user:skripty:pspad:pspad-okno.png?600|Základní okno programu s právě otevřeným skriptem}} {{:user:skripty:pspad:pspad-okno.png?600|Základní okno programu s právě otevřeným skriptem}}
Line 23: Line 23:
 Poté už stačí jen po úpravách skriptu stisknout **Ctrl+F9** a v LOG okně PSPadu se Vám zobrazí výsledek překladu. Pokud skript obsahuje chybu, je červeně zvýrazněna. Pokud se vypíše chyb či varování více, lze na odpovídající řádek skriptu přejít poklepáním na řádek s chybou v LOG okně. Poté už stačí jen po úpravách skriptu stisknout **Ctrl+F9** a v LOG okně PSPadu se Vám zobrazí výsledek překladu. Pokud skript obsahuje chybu, je červeně zvýrazněna. Pokud se vypíše chyb či varování více, lze na odpovídající řádek skriptu přejít poklepáním na řádek s chybou v LOG okně.
  
 +====== Zvýraznění syntaxe v programu PSPad ======
 +Jelikož program PSPad umožňuje definování vlastních zvýrazňovačů syntaxe, bylo by škoda toho nevyužít i v GeoGetu.
 +
 +{{:user:skripty:pspad:pspad-zvyraznovace.jpg?200|}}
 +
 +===== GgStat =====
 +Zvýrazňuje všechny známé příkazy používané v šablonách statistik pro program [[user:skript:ggstat|GgStat]].
 +
 +{{:user:skripty:pspad:pspad-ggstat.jpg?200|}}
 +{{:user:skripty:pspad:pspad-ggstat-syntax-20121125.zip|}}
 +
 +===== GgsExpr =====
 +Zvýrazňuje příkazy v pluginech programu [[user:skript:ggsexpr|GgsExpr]], který rozšiřuje možnosti [[user:skript:ggstat|GgStatu]].
 +
 +{{:user:skripty:pspad:pspad-ggsexpr.jpg?200|}}
 +{{:user:skripty:pspad:pspad-ggsexpr-syntax-20121125.zip|}}
 +
 +===== Ostatní =====
 +Dalším užitečným zvýrazňovačem může být například Wherigo, které napsal me2d09. Více na http://www.wherigo.cz/tvorime/lua-tvorime/psani-cartridge-v-pspadu/
 +
 +====== Tipy, triky ======
 +Také vám v PSPadu nejdou otevřít fieldnotes? Respektive při otevření souboru ''geocache_visits.txt'' se otevře PSPad v režimu HEXeditoru? Náprava je opravdu jednoduchá: Nastavení -> Nastavení programu... -> Přímá editace a zde v sekci ''[Special settings]'' změnte ''AutoDetectBinary=1'' na ''AutoDetectBinary=0'' to je vše.
 +Aneb jak (mi) píše autor programu
 +> PSpad otevre soubor v HEXa editoru v pripade, ze se v souboru vyskytuji znaky, ktere v normalnim textu nemaji co delat. Obvykle jde o ridici znaky s ASCII hodnotou pod 32.
 +> Tato detekce je predrazena detekci kodove stranky.
 +> Pokud ji chcete vypnout, jdete do nastaveni programu / prima editace a tam zmente: autodetectbinnary=0
 +> Jan Fiala
user/skripty/pspad.1342445176.txt.gz · Last modified: 2012/07/16 00:00 (external edit)